- ベストアンサー
一行に並んだ時間と単価をその行にて合計するには?
cafe_au_laitの回答
- cafe_au_lait
- ベストアンサー率51% (143/276)
すみません。A列を含めるとエラーになりますね。 =SUMPRODUCT(B3:F3*C3:G3*MOD(COLUMN(A3:E3),2))
関連するQ&A
- エクセル 時間の合計数が適正に表示されません
添付のようなタイムシートを作成しましたが、「合計の時間数」が適正に表示されません。 D12、E12には正しくない合計時間数が表示され、 F12、G12に至っては、表示すらされません(TT) 間違っているのではなく、適正な表示になってくれていないだけだろうなとは理解できるのですが なぜこんな表示になってしまうのか、まったくわかりません。 どなたかご教示いただけないでしょうか。 よろしくお願いいたしますm(_ _)m 各列の関数は以下のとおりです。 D列=C-B-J E列=MIN("8:00",D) F列=D-K G列=C-I 合計のセルは次のように設定しています。 D12=SUM(D5:D11) E12=SUM(E5:E11) F12=SUM(F5:F11) G12=SUM(G5:G11) 各セルの表示形式は、 [h]:mm;; です。 よろしくお願いいたしますm(_ _)m
- ベストアンサー
- Excel(エクセル)
- 残業時間の合計が
B F列 開始時間 C G列 退社時間 D H列 残業時間 E I列 残業手当 を入れて31日まで入れています。 下記のような数式を(H9)に入れて31日分まで(H39) =IF(AND($F9<G$9,$G9>D$5),MIN($G9)-MAX($F9,D$5),0) 31日分まで(H39)までコピーしています 残業時間の合計時間ですが =SUM(D9:D39) この列はちゃんとイイです =SUM(H9:H39) この列は30日迄はいいのですが31日 に入力されると0.00となります 30日迄はいいのです なにが問題なのか困っています どなたかご指導いただけませんか
- ベストアンサー
- オフィス系ソフト
- 数式が入った空白のセルを合計するとき
数式が入った空白のセルを合計するとき WINDOWS XP EXCELL 2003 です。 各セルの数式は C43 =SUM(B36-C36) D36 =SUMPRODUCT((入力!$C$2:$C$50=$A36)*(入力!$A$2:$A$50=D$1),入力!$E$2:$E$50) E36 =SUMPRODUCT((入力!$D$2:$D$50=$A36)*(入力!$A$2:$A$50=D$1),入力!$F$2:$F$50) E43 =SUM(C43+D36-E36) と数式がそれぞれに入っています。 ご教示を仰ぎたいのは D36,E36 に値がない空白のセルですがこの場合、E43 G43 I43 と表示(この場合 50,000)がされますがD36 若しくはE36に値が表示されたときのみにE43 を表示したいのですが可能でしょうか。 目的は見やすくしたいのですが。 ご指導いたたければ幸甚の至りです。
- ベストアンサー
- その他MS Office製品
- エクセル・時間の合計が合わない
実労働時間の1ヶ月の合計をだすのに、SUMを使ったのですが、 合計がすごく小さい数字になります。 表示は※※:※※で表示しています。 表の内容は下記の通りです。 4行目に題名 ・B出勤時刻・C休憩開始・D休憩終了・E退社時刻 F4・I4・L4・N4・Q4=0:00 G4・J4・M4・O4・R4=17:00 F =IF($E5-F$4>0,$E5-F$4,0)-IF($B5-F$4>0,$B5-F$4,0) G =IF($E5-G$4>0,$E5-G$4,0)-IF($B5-G$4>0,$B5-G$4,0) I =F5-SUM(J5:$K5) L =IF($D5-L$4>0,$D5-L$4,0)-IF($C5-L$4>0,$C5-L$4,0) M =IF($D5-M$4>0,$D5-M$4,0)-IF($C5-M$4>0,$C5-M$4,0) N =L5-SUM(O5:$P5) O =M5-SUM(P5:$P5) Q =I5-N5 (実労働時間17時までの1日の計) R =J5-O5 (実労働時間17時からの1日の計) Qに=SUM(Q5:Q14) Rに=SUM(R5:R14) を入力しましたが、まったく違う時間数になります。 どうすれば正しい計算式がでるのでしょうか? お教え願いたくお願い申し上げます。
- ベストアンサー
- オフィス系ソフト
- 条件に合うものの合計
エクセルでA列に「名前=山下、佐藤、田中、佐藤、田中、近藤、山下…等」で。B列に「100,90,70,120、30、50、5」などがあり、田中の合計は70+30=100、山下の合計は100+5=105というように、集計したいのですが…よろしくお願いします>
- ベストアンサー
- オフィス系ソフト
- 数量×単価+数量×単価... 合計を出すどういう関数式になりますか?
A B C D E F G H I 1 A4 A3 A2 A1 2 個数 単価 個数 単価 個数 単価 個数 単価 合計 3 5 8.9 1 17.8 6 10.5 ☆ 単価にはIF関数を使いその列ごとに個数が入力されると単価も自動的に表示されるように設定しています 1行目のA1とB2は結合されています。また他のセルも同様に結合されています A2に個数、B1に単価、C1に個数、D1に単価と交互に数値が入っています。 個数×単価の全ての合計を合計のセル☆に求めたいです。 またE列、F列には個数がないということで、ここには数値をいれたくなく、また「0」を入力しない状態でエラーが出ないようにしたいですその場合どんな関数式になりますか?本当はもっとセルに単価と数量が続いています。自分で考えるととても長い関数になってしまいます。 スマートな関数式と効率のいい関数式を探しています。どなたかよろしくお願いします。
- 締切済み
- オフィス系ソフト
- 2箇所にまたがる同じ名前のセルの合計は?
例えばA列が名前、B列が点数、連続してC列が名前、D列が点数・・・・・・ というように、A列にある『田中』全員のB列の点数計とC列にある『田中』全員のD列の点数計を1つのセルで集計するには?SUMIFではエラーが出ますし、SUMPRODUCTでも思った答えになりません。2箇所にまたがった集計をするという非常に単純なことで、分からない自分がちょっとむかつくのですが^_^;宜しくお願い致します。
- ベストアンサー
- オフィス系ソフト
- 同じ行に混在している別々の項目の抜き出し
Excelにて困りごとです。 同じ行に、例えばA列に「佐藤」「田中」「山田」の氏名がランダムに何回も(例えば100行ランダムに)書いてあり、B列に毎回のテストの点数、C列にテストを受けた日付が記載してあるとします。 これを各受講者ずつ抜き出して、佐藤さんの場合はD列に点数、E列に日付、田中さんはF列に点数、G列に日付、というように並べるには、どういう関数を使えばいいでしょうか?
- 締切済み
- オフィス系ソフト
- エクセル 長い式を短くする(切捨てる場合)
エクセル 長い式を短くする(切捨てる場合) OSはXP エクセル2000です。 よろしくお願いします。 A1 B1 ... F1 G1 2単価 1800 2250 ... 1625 3数1 10.75 0.5 .. 0.25 33824 4数2 0.5 1.5 ... 2 44250 G1=単価×数にて金額を出すためにTRUNCを使って切り捨てをしています。 G1=TRUNC(B2*B4)+TRUNC(C2*C4)+TRUNC(D2*D4)+TRUNC(E2*E4)... とすると式がものすごく長くなります。 G1=TRUNC(SUMPRODUCT($B$2:$F2,B3:F3)) とすると1円の誤差がでる場合があります。 よい方法はありますか?
- ベストアンサー
- オフィス系ソフト
- 残業時間月合計(エクセル)を正確に計算できません
エクセル2007で,勤務時間を管理表を作成していますが,残業時間月合計(G36のセル)が正確に計算されません。 社員に入力してもらうのは,出勤時間と退社時間だけです。 勤務時間(在勤時間)は8:25~16:55で,途中の休憩時間は考慮しません。 項目と入力してある関数は下のとおりです。 A B C D E F G 日 曜日 出勤時間 退社時間 在勤時間 基本在勤時間 残業時間 5 1 金 8:15 17:00 8時間30分 8:30 0時間15分 6 2 土 9:00 10:10 1時間10分 0:00 1時間10分 36 月合計 229時間40分 68:10 68時間10分 E列の関数・・・「=D5-C5」(表示形式は h"時間"mm"分") F列(非表示)・・・平日は「8:30」と入力(8:25~16:55が8時間30分であるため) 土日・休日は「0:00」と入力(勤務日でないため) G列の関数・・・「=D5-C5-F5」(表示形式は h"時間"mm"分") E36の関数「=SUM(E5:E35)」(表示形式は [h]"時間"mm"分") F36の関数「=SUM(F5:F35)」(表示形式は [h]:mm) G36の関数=SUM(G5:G35)」(表示形式は [h]"時間"mm"分") 平日で,C列とD列が入力していないのに,F列に8:00が入力してあるため,G列の計算がマイナスになることが原因で正確に計算できないのでしょうか。 簡単な関数を使って正確に残業時間月合計が計算できる方法を教えてください。 よろしくお願いします。
- ベストアンサー
- オフィス系ソフト
お礼
ありがとうございました。 無事解決いたしました。 又何かありましたら宜しくお願い致します。